Summary:An enterprise resource planning (ERP) system is a software that helps organisations to manage their core processes, including assets, inventory, order requests, financial accounting, and human resources. This study explores the ERP implementation challenges in a telecommunications company. This study is a qualitative study, where a single case study approach was used (in a company given the pseudonym FESB) to collect data using a semi-structured interview. The data was analysed by using thematic analysis. The findings suggest that the main challenges faced by FESB during ERP implementation are technology, data migration, training and learning and management. In this context, these factors contribute to the delayed ERP implementation in FESB, which is targeted to be implemented in July 2022. The findings suggest that FESB should utilise the system’s capabilities more than currently; the system implementation is at the data migration stage and is not fully used. This research contributes to the challenges to ERP implementation in the context of a telecommunications company.
